<?php declare(strict_types=1); namespace GeoIp2\Record; /** * Contains data for the location record associated with an IP address. * * This record is returned by all location services and databases besides * Country. * * @property-read int|null $averageIncome The average income in US dollars * associated with the requested IP address. This attribute is only available * from the Insights service. * @property-read int|null $accuracyRadius The approximate accuracy radius in * kilometers around the latitude and longitude for the IP address. This is * the radius where we have a 67% confidence that the device using the IP * address resides within the circle centered at the latitude and longitude * with the provided radius. * @property-read float|null $latitude The approximate latitude of the location * associated with the IP address. This value is not precise and should not be * used to identify a particular address or household. * @property-read float|null $longitude The approximate longitude of the location * associated with the IP address. This value is not precise and should not be * used to identify a particular address or household. * @property-read int|null $populationDensity The estimated population per square * kilometer associated with the IP address. This attribute is only available * from the Insights service. * @property-read int|null $metroCode The metro code of the location if the location * is in the US. MaxMind returns the same metro codes as the * Google AdWords API. See * https://developers.google.com/adwords/api/docs/appendix/cities-DMAregions. * @property-read string|null $timeZone The time zone associated with location, as * specified by the IANA Time Zone Database, e.g., "America/New_York". See * https://www.iana.org/time-zones. */ class Location extends AbstractRecord { /** * @ignore * * @var array<string> */ protected $validAttributes = [ 'averageIncome', 'accuracyRadius', 'latitude', 'longitude', 'metroCode', 'populationDensity', 'postalCode', 'postalConfidence', 'timeZone', ]; }
